Dr. Johnny Fever, played by Howard Hesseman, was a radio DJ on the 1970s TV series "WKRP in Cincinnati." The character was known for his laid-back attitude and humorous personality, often providing a comedic contrast to the more serious staff at the radio station. His character became iconic for representing the free-spirited culture of the era and the burgeoning rock 'n' roll scene.
